1. Nora Fatehi
Nora Fatehi is yet another foreigner to get a break in the Bollywood and she is of Moroccan origin. She debuted in Bollywood through the movie ‘Roar – Tigers of the Sundarbans’ which was directed by Kamal Sadanah. She played the character of a commando who is on a mission to find and kill a man-killer tigress. The superhot model was already famous for her killer looks and the movie gave her a huge boost.
After her first movie in 2013, she became so popular and bagged the lead role in director Prakash Jha’s movie ‘Crazy Cukkad Family’ and also did a special appearance role in one of the songs in the Emraan Hashmi starrer ‘Mr.X’. She went on to do an item number in the Puri Jaganath directed Telugu movie ‘Temper’ which became a huge hit. She became popular in the Tollywood industry after ‘Temper’, and went on to do special appearances in the 2015 movies ‘Baahubali’ and ‘Kick 2’.
The Canadian supermodel is so fond of dancing and has stated in an interview that NTR Jr. is her favourite dancer to work with. She confessed that she had been looking for someone who has got amazing moves to work with and NTR surprised her while shooting for ‘Temper’.

4. Nitya Mehra
Nitya Mehra is a female film director to make her presence felt in Bollywood. In the male dominated world where only male directors had often taken a huge share so far in the field of direction, Nitya manages to climb the ladder slowly, Currently, Nitya is also one to create a feature film named ‘Baar Baar Dekho’ and experiment with casting of Katrina Kaif and Sidharth Malhotra. Producer of this movie is Ritesh Sidhwani, Farhan Akhtar, and Sunil A Lulla. The film ‘Baar Baar Dekho’ is expected to release in September 2016 and Nitya shares her position as a co-film director along with Sri Rao. She made her directorial debut on new project ‘Baar Baar Dekho’ with Excel Entertainment in 2015.
...5. Reema Kagti
Reema Kagti is an assistant director, director and writer. She is known for her work in mainstream Hindi cinema. She has directed a few noted movies such as ‘Honeymoon Travels Pvt. Ltd.’ (2007) & ‘Talaash’ (2012). She also worked as an assistant director in other movies such as ‘Dil Chahta Hai’ (2001), ‘Lakshya’ (2004), ‘Lagaan’ (2001), ‘Armaan’ (2003) & ‘Vanity Fair’ (2004). She belongs to ‘Assam’ and was born in the capital of the state ‘Guwahati’. She completed her graduation from the ‘Sophia College’, Mumbai and after that she aimed at making a career in the world of entertainment.
...6. Zoya Akhtar
Zoya Akhtar has now become a household name prominently known for her movie Zindagi Na Milegi Dobara as the most entertaining director. She is just three films old in the industry, but she earned applauses for her work; she bagged Filmfare award for best director in movie Zindagi Na Milegi Dobara. She was born on 14th October 1972 to industry’s most renowned writer, poet and lyricist Javed Akhtar and screenwriter Honey Irani. She had her schooling at Maneckji Cooper and completed her graduation at St. Xavier’s College.
...7. Bhumi Pednekar
Bhumi Pednekar is Maharashtrian unconventional actress. Bhumi was initially an assistant to the casting director of Yash Raj Films; and recently made her debut under the Yash Raj Films banner by starring in Dum Laga Ke Haisha starring Ayushmann Khurrana. She holds that it was like a “Cinderella moment” for her when she was asked to play the role of the leading actor in the movie. Bhumi plays the role of Sandhya an over-weight girl in her debut movie. She had to gain about 15 kilograms for her role in the movie but has now lost a lot of weight and is back at being fit.
Bhumi Pednekar might not be a well-known name in the Bollywood industry just yet but given her performance in her first movie that released in February 2015, the days are not far. Bhumi dreams of romancing with Shah Rukh Khan and Salman Khan on screen. Her favorite actress is Karisma Kapoor and mentioned that she was obsessed with her role in Raja Hindustani when she was 12 years old. She is being called an unconventional Bollywood actress due to her weight issues. Bhumi always had weight issues which make her different from the other stick-thin actresses of Bollywood; and the part where she loves herself and her body despite being a little over-weight is what makes her command respect.

...11. Sushant Singh Rajput
Sushant Singh Rajput is one of the famous Indian television and film actors. He was born on 21st January, 1986 in Patna. His father use to work in a government office. In early 2000s, his family moved to Delhi. Rajput is the younger brother to his four sisters. He has completed his schooling from St. Karen's High School located in Patna and Kulachi Hansraj Model School located in New Delhi. After that, he joined in DCE (Delhi College of Engineering), but after 3 years he has decided to drop out for his acting career.
He has chosen to perform in 2006 Commonwealth Games and the background dancer group at the 51st Film fare Awards. After shifting to Mumbai also he started to involve in theater plays and also became a member of Nadira Babbar's Ekjute theater group.
He began his career as a backup dancer and based on his performance, Balaji Films given him a TV role. His acting career consists of several Television serials, Films etc., He acted in TV serials like Kis Desh Mein Hai Mere Dil, Pavitra Rishta, Zara Nachke Dikha and Jhalak Dikhhla Jaa 4. He also acted in films like Kai PO Che, Shuddh Desi Romance, etc., He got several awards like Indian Telly Awards, Zee Gold Awards, Star Build Awards and IIFA Awards and many more.
He is going to play a confirmed role in the next upcoming venture named "P.K." and a film called "Detective Byomkesh Bakshi" and going to be acting as a star role in film "Pani". He is one of the young and inspiring actors in India.
